Accessibility

We want the archive to be usable with a keyboard, a screen reader, magnification and reduced motion. This page describes what is in place and how to tell us when something blocks you.

01What is implemented

Semantic landmarks for header, navigation, main content and footer, with a single H1 per page and ordered heading levels inside articles.

Full keyboard operability with a visible focus indicator on every interactive element, and touch targets sized for comfortable use on phones.

Body text and interface labels are checked against the dark theme for contrast, and colour is never the only way information is conveyed — market moves also carry a sign and a value.

Motion is minimal, and all transitions are disabled automatically when your system requests reduced motion.

Images carry alternative text where the source archive provided it, and decorative graphics are hidden from assistive technology.

02Known limitations

This site includes a large imported archive. Some older articles contain markup, tables or embedded media created before current accessibility practice, including images without descriptive alternative text. We correct these as they are identified.
